2025 Automotive Industry Shifts Impacting Sea Freight Solutions
The automotive industry evolves rapidly in 2025, reshaping sea freight demands for global supply chains.
Electric vehicle (EV) production surges 25% worldwide, per IEA data.
- EV battery demand spikes 40%, boosting sea freight volumes for components.
- Tariffs prompt rerouting from Asia to US/Europe ports.
- Chip shortages linger, prioritizing just-in-time sea freight for semiconductors.
- Sustainable shipping rises with green fuel mandates.
These changes require robust sea freight solutions tailored to automotive parts like engines and chassis.
Key 2025 HS Code Changes for Automotive Sea Freight
HS code updates in 2025 directly affect sea freight compliance in automotive logistics.
No major WCO revisions until 2027, but national changes demand attention.
| Region | 2025 HS Change | Automotive HS Example | Sea Freight Impact |
| USA | De minimis ends Aug 29 | HS 8708 (parts) | Full HTS filing; delays up 20% |
| GCC | 12-digit HS from Jan 1 | HS 8507 (batteries) | Fines for misclassification |
| EU | Combined Nomenclature update | HS 8703 (vehicles) | EV import tariffs rise 5-10% |
Automakers must adapt sea freight strategies to these HS shifts for smooth global supply chains.
Optimizing Sea Freight Routes for Automotive Global Supply Chains in 2025
Select optimal sea freight routes to handle 2025 automotive supply chain volatility.
- Asia-US West Coast: 18-25 days for batteries and parts.
- Europe alternatives: Cape of Good Hope bypasses Red Sea risks.
- LCL consolidation cuts costs 15% for mixed auto parts.
- RoRo ships ideal for finished vehicles, reducing damage.
- Trans-Pacific lanes prioritize speed for just-in-time delivery.
Monitor real-time disruptions for resilient sea freight solutions.
How to Classify Automotive Parts for Sea Freight Compliance (5-Step Guide)
Follow this step-by-step process for accurate HS classification in 2025 sea freight.
- Identify material: Use HS Chapter 87 for vehicles/parts.
- Check regional 2025 updates: US HTS, EU TARIC, GCC 12-digit.
- Consult WCO database: Verify subheadings online.
- Calculate tariffs: Access national customs portals.
- Document thoroughly: Label for sea freight manifests.
This ensures seamless automotive sea freight through global supply chains.
Cost-Saving Strategies for Automotive Sea Freight in 2025
Implement proven tips to reduce sea freight costs in the evolving automotive industry.
- Book Q1 for off-peak EV rates, saving 20%.
- Bundle FCL across suppliers for volume discounts.
- Choose FCA Incoterms to control sea freight leg.
- Track fuel surcharges and negotiate clauses.
- Shift to LCL for parts under 1 ton.
These sea freight solutions optimize global automotive supply chains.
Navigating Disruptions: Red Sea Impact on Automotive Sea Freight
Red Sea issues add 14+ days and 30% costs to automotive sea freight routes.
- Cape routing: Essential for Europe-bound EVs.
- Alternative ports: Mumbai to Rotterdam in 25 days.
- Inventory buffers: Stock 45 days for delays.
Proactive planning fortifies automotive global supply chains.
Sustainable Sea Freight Solutions for Automotive Logistics 2025
Green initiatives shape 2025 sea freight for eco-conscious automotive supply chains.
- Methanol vessels reduce emissions by 90% on key lanes.
- IMO 2025 sulfur caps demand compliant fuels.
- Carbon offset programs for full shipments.
- EV battery recycling routes via sea freight.
Sustainability enhances brand value in global automotive logistics.
